Solve b+12≤26. Graph the solution

Mathematics
1 answer:
Vladimir79 [104]3 years ago
6 0

Answer:

The answer is

b≤14

So you make a filled in circle at 14, make the point for left from there.

A cube box has a side length of 7 feet . what is the total surface area of the mix?
Tomtit [17]

Answer:

294

Step-by-step explanation:

SA   = 6x^{2}

       = 6 (7^{2} )

294  =  6 (49)
